Kane Partners LLC is seeking a skilled Heat Treatment Engineer to collaborate with our quality, manufacturing, and engineering teams in Philadelphia. The ideal candidate will have expertise in heat treatment processes, including furnace designs, heat delivery, electronic controls, and process gases.

Key Responsibilities:

• Design, implement, and optimize heat treatment processes to meet product specifications and quality standards.

• Create electrical schematics and panel drawings while maintaining industry standards and compliances.

• Lead and manage projects related to heat treatment process improvements, including planning, execution, and evaluation.

• Proficiency in PLC programming and relay logic, with a working understanding of AMS2750, NADCAP, ISO9001, NFPA 86, NEC, and Confined Space protocol.

• Bachelor's degree in industrial engineering, mechanical engineering, or electrical engineering is strongly preferred.

Requirements:

• 5 years of experience working in a heat-treating facility with a strong background in troubleshooting, process controls, electrical equipment, and PLC programs.

•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ams.
